The Opportunity

The Division Manager of SourceToPay Transformation is responsible for leading driving and implementing a new enterprise eprocurement system for Los Angeles County. The individual will work closely with executives and key stakeholders across County departments to optimize the SourceToPay process and drive efficiency effectiveness and deliver largescale transformation programs in a high matrixed organization consisting of over 40 County Departments with a combined annual spend of over $10B. The role requires a strategic systems mindset strong leadership skills and the ability to deliver results through change management process improvement and analytics. This involves setting endtoend policies managing budgets and schedules and overall leadership and management of SourceToPay processes.

Fair Chance Initiative:
The County of Los Angeles is a Fair Chance employer. Except for a very limited number of positions you will not be asked to provide information about a conviction history unless you receive a contingent offer of employment. The County will make an individualized assessment of whether your conviction history has a direct or adverse relationship with the specific duties of the job and consider potential mitigating factors including but not limited to evidence and extent of rehabilitation recency of the offense(s) and age at the time of the offense(s). If asked to provide information about a conviction history any convictions or court records which are exempted by a valid court order do not have to be disclosed.
